340315b6e9 parity_venv.sh: swap the environment it claims to swap
The script exported UV_PROJECT_ENVIRONMENT and then reached for `uv pip`, which
does not honour it — it discovers an environment the way pip does, so the
uninstall and install landed in the app's own .venv. The sanity check that
follows could not notice, because `uv run` *does* honour the variable and so
read the untouched parity venv. Net effect: the swap happened in the wrong
place and reported success. Inc 0's parity claim never exercised the parity
venv at all.

Two fixes, since the second only surfaced once the first was in:

- `uv pip` gets --python pointing at the parity venv.
- everything afterwards runs that venv's interpreter directly. `uv run` re-syncs
  the environment against the app's manifest before running, and the manifest
  still asks for cadquery-ocp-novtk, so it reinstalled the stock wheel on top of
  the swap. The usage note at the top said to drive the app's tests that way
  too; it now says to use the venv's python.

Also pins `uv sync --python 3.12`, so the parity venv keeps resembling what the
image ships instead of following whatever interpreter is newest on the box, and
turns the sanity print into an assertion on __occt_version__ — an attribute
only our wheel defines, which makes it a check that the swap landed.

Verified end to end against the published 7.9.3.1.dev2: installs anonymously
from the Gitea index, 31 modules, ocp suite 48 passed, and the app's main venv
is left on stock.

6139852768 Phase 10A/10B Inc 0: build system, handle model, first module surface
Builds n3xd-ocp end to end and publishes 7.9.3.1.dev1 to the Gitea registry,
where it installs anonymously and passes its suite.

- occt/Dockerfile: OCCT 7.9.3 compiled once into a manylinux_2_28 builder
  image (base digest + tarball sha256 pinned), Draw/VTK/Tk/Xlib/OpenGL off,
  FreeType on, -O2 without fast-math or march=native. A final layer asserts
  TKService/TKV3d exist with no libGL/libX11 DT_NEEDED, which is what lets the
  app image drop libgl1/libx11-6. Mounted into, never built FROM.
- scikit-build-core + nanobind STABLE_ABI -> one cp312-abi3 extension that
  registers every OCP.* submodule via PyImport_AddModule, so `import
  OCP.TopoDS` needs no shim and cls.__module__ is right. Version <occt>.N is
  asserted against the OCCT found, keeping occt_version() truthful.
- occt_handle.h: type caster for opencascade::handle<T> over OCCT's intrusive
  refcount. Wrappers are non-owning instances holding exactly one handle in
  their keep-alive list, reusing an existing wrapper so identity survives a
  round trip. Transient constructors go through ocp_new (never nb::init<>,
  which would let OCCT delete nanobind's storage); the caster refuses a
  refcount-0 object rather than corrupt the heap. Verified under ASAN with no
  memory-safety errors, plus an RSS bound over 50k create/destroy cycles.
- Sub-shapes are returned by value everywhere, making the TShape lifetime class
  that segfaulted a process-global face memo unrepresentable.
- Standard_Failure derives RuntimeError, with ~20 concrete types dispatched on
  the dynamic OCCT type (cad_pool marshals failures home by type name).
- Inc 0 surface: gp subset, TopAbs, TopoDS (+ downcasts), TopExp, TopLoc,
  TopTools, BRep, BinTools, Poly, Standard. 34 of the app's 139 symbols.
- n3xd_ocp: additive APIs kept out of the OCP namespace so parity testing stays
  meaningful. bintools (shape <-> bytes, GIL-free, byte-identical) and _debug.

Two findings worth the record, both verified against the stock wheel rather
than assumed: upstream binds __hash__ but leaves __eq__ at identity, which is
exactly what geom_memo.py's hash-bucket + IsSame scan is built around, so we
match it instead of "fixing" it; and BinTools can release the GIL after all, by
slurping the file-like object instead of bridging a streambuf that would call
back into Python.

Gate: BREP round-trips are byte-identical to cadquery-ocp-novtk across six
fixtures (the generator asserts stock idempotency first). That matters beyond
IPC — derive.py content-addresses BREP payloads by sha256 and stores the ref.
